Thanks guys.

I believe the car is mostly in stock condition apart from the routine parts replaced over time. Recently had the timing belt replaced with new "stock" distributor placed. Nothing has been replaced with electronic parts. Missing the dome light cover. All vintage original emblems and light assemblies still working and intact. I believe the plastic parts like the shifter boot is also vintage stock. Almost no rust inside, around and under the body. New "stock" muffler welded since the old one had a hole in it.
